List by list

  • England and Wales · Boys23 shared years, 19982024

    Atticus held the stronger position in 12 of those years, Jaeden in 8.

    Highest recorded here: Atticus #298 in 2024, Jaeden #958 in 2011.

    The order changed in 2012: Atticus moved ahead. In 2011 they stood at #958 and #958; by 2012 that had become #765 and #1367.

    Most recent shared year, 2024: Atticus #298, Jaeden #3688.
